"Summer in the City" is a song by the Canadian-American #folkrock band the Lovin' Spoonful. Written by #JohnSebastian, Mark Sebastian and #SteveBoone, the song was released as a non-album single in July 1966 and was included on the album #HumsOfTheLovinSpoonful later that year.
"You Didn't Have to Be So Nice" is a song by the Canadian-American #folkrock band #theLovinSpoonful. Written by #JohnSebastian and #SteveBoone, it was issued on a non-album single in November 1965. The song was the Spoonful's second-consecutive single to enter the top ten in the United States.
